There is precisely a reason why it should be that demanding -> inside that station is nothing like optimizing for a cockpit from a planes perspective. You're up close to many planes, and because of the "medium" distance you are to them, you still need full detail but unlike being in another plane, you have full view of all other planes, and a large part of the carrier itself and all of the people on deck.
And I wonder why people like you have such short AF memory. Just about a year ago mulithreading was released for DCS and on average people saw a full on 40% increase because just about everyone has at least 4-6 cores, with some seeing up to 80% performance increase -- those with powerful GPUs and 8-16 core systems (double the threads). No other games even come CLOSE to utilizing that many cores effectively. Even when compare to photo and video editors rendering, or compiling a large Rust project, DCS exploits my system's most valuable resources and puts them to work. With DCS, I see somewhere betweenn 30-40% CPU usage on a 5950x (that's 16 cores, 32 threads), and 95-98% GPU. The average game looks like 4-5% CPU, and 95-98%% GPU. @@danieldorn9989 what do external views lack? From an external view, if you move the PoV into a cockpit, do you see the same cockpit as the full fidelity module? If you push into one do all of the switch positions, textures, avionics, and gauges are reading correctly? Absolutely not. That rendering is left to actually being in the cockpit view and renders that stuff in a highly optimized, and dynamic way different from the generalized, outside DCS world, along with massive frustrum culling of the outside world because the airframe itself occludes so much of the outside world from the pilot’s view.
As you say, external views don’t have the culling, but they also don’t have the cockpit to worry about. It’s a basic LOD issue, and the rendering pipeline never has to switch up to render the cockpit from external views - an efficiency increase when you can render more objects using the same rendering pipeline configuration.
Super carrier is effectively a cockpit, but as much larger one at that, with far more complex (at least radically different) culling needed. It’s a room, but those aren’t static textures. It actually reflects the state of the carrier deck so it’s dynamically generated. I’m not saying it can’t or won’t get better and more optimized, but it’s absolutely “something different” for the graphics team to deal with and it just released.
I’m not trying to use fancy words, frustrum culling / occlusion culling is just removing geometry that can be determined is absolutely not in view in any part.

@@SCP_Site_638 In your DCS World folder you have a bin folder in which your ST executable is located (DCS.exe), and in bin-mt you have your MT executable located (also DCS.exe). Just run the game from the DCS.exe located in the bin-mt folder.
